dc.description.abstractFriction welding is widespread used in various industries nowadays. In the friction welding, heat is generated by conversion of mechanical energy into thermal energy at the interface of the work pieces during rotation under pressure. Generally, friction welding can easily be used to joint the components that have circular or non-circular cross sections. Friction time, friction pressure, forging time, forging pressure and rotation speed are the most interesting parameters in friction welding method. High material save, low production time and low energy expenditure are some of the other advantages of friction welding. The main aim of the present study is to prepare a computer program simulating how to occur the weld flashes in the welded joints having equal diameter or different diameter, AISI 1040 (medium carbon steel). The properties of the program are such as below: The program was coded with Microsoft(R) Visual Basic(TM) 6.0 The Models 3D are prepared with 3D Studio Max(R) R3 While some coatings are prepared Paint Shop Pro(TM) 7.0 and made optimize, some coatings are obtained from library of 3D Studio Max(R) and, the running of the program, volume deformation functions found and various simulation examples were given in this study. Then, obtained results were compared with those of the experiments. (C) 2004 Published by Elsevier B.V.en_US
